flatex is a prominent German online broker that has been serving European retail traders since 1999. Headquartered in Frankfurt, the company is part of the flatex DEGIRO group, one of the largest financial service providers in Europe. While flatex is widely known among German investors for its low-cost trading of stocks, ETFs, and derivatives, it also offers forex trading to international clients, including those in France.
For French traders, flatex brings a unique value proposition: the security of a fully licensed bank combined with transparent, low-cost pricing. Its platform is designed for efficiency, and the ability to trade a broad range of asset classes – from major forex pairs to global indices and commodities – makes it a versatile choice. flatex has its roots in the traditional banking world, which means it places a strong emphasis on regulatory compliance and client fund protection.
Given its European background, flatex is well adapted to the needs of French clients. It supports SEPA bank transfers, accepts both French national ID and passport for verification, and offers local payment alternatives such as Skrill and USDT. While it may not be the most specialized forex broker on the market, its reputation, low costs, and regulatory clarity make it a respected option for traders in France.

flatex does not currently advertise an Islamic (swap-free) account option for its clients in France. This is a significant limitation for Muslim traders who must avoid earning or paying interest (riba) as part of their religious beliefs. Swap fees are automatically applied to positions held overnight on many CFDs and forex pairs, which means standard flatex accounts are not Sharia-compliant.
There is a possibility that flatex may accommodate swap-free conditions on a case-by-case basis if requested directly, but this is not a guaranteed feature and there is no publicly documented policy. French Muslim traders seeking a truly Islamic account should look for brokers that offer clearly stated swap-free accounts with no hidden administrative fees. It is also important to verify whether the broker removes any spread markup in place of swap charges, as some brokers offset the lost interest by widening the spread. Until flatex introduces an official Islamic account, it remains a less suitable choice for Sharia-compliant trading.

flatex is a reliable and well-regulated choice for France traders who value security and low overall trading costs over the latest forex-specific features. It excels in its European banking heritage, transparent fee structure, and broad asset availability, making it a viable option for both long-term investors and occasional forex traders. If you primarily trade mainstream currency pairs and are comfortable with a proprietary platform, flatex provides a safe and efficient trading environment with the backing of a major German bank.
However, for French retail forex traders who prioritize ultra-tight spreads, MetaTrader integration, or Islamic account availability, flatex is not the best fit. The absence of French-language support and educational materials is also noticeable in a country where many traders seek local-language resources. In summary, flatex is recommended for conservative, cost-conscious traders in France who want a multipurpose European broker with strong regulation; active scalpers and Sharia-conscious Muslims should look elsewhere.
